What the SAMHSA Record Shows About Wedge Medical Center

Wedge Medical Center is a mental health treatment operated by Private non-profit organization in Philadelphia, Pennsylvania. The facility's N-SUMHSS record lists 2 primary care modalities (outpatient, telehealth), which shapes both how treatment is delivered and how intake is scheduled. MAT is not listed in the current record; callers seeking medication-assisted options should verify directly or check the rankings pages for nearby providers that do offer MAT. The full postal address on file is 6701 North Broad Street, Philadelphia, PA 19126.

On the services side, the facility self-reports 6 distinct service lines (Co-occurring disorder treatment, Cognitive behavioral therapy, Mental health treatment, Outpatient, Suicide prevention services, Telehealth), 0 substance or condition categories treated, and 8 clinical treatment approaches (Abnormal involuntary movement scale, Activity therapy, Cognitive behavioral therapy, Couples/family therapy, Group therapy, Individual psychotherapy, Integrated Mental and Substance Use Disorder treatment, Telemedicine/telehealth therapy). It serves 11 specific population groups (Adolescents, Adults, Children with serious emotional disturbance, Justice-involved individuals, Persons who have experienced trauma, Persons with DUI/DWI, Persons with PTSD, Persons with co-occurring disorders, Persons with serious mental illness, Seniors, Young adults) with 6 languages of care (Any Chinese Language, Other languages (excluding Spanish), Sign language services for the deaf and hard of hearing, Spanish, Tagalog, Vietnamese). Those figures give a rough signal of programmatic breadth, a higher number of approaches and populations usually indicates more structured clinical programming rather than a single-modality operation. Payment-wise, the record confirms Medicaid, Medicare, plus 3 specific payment methods enumerated in the survey (Cash or self-payment, Medicaid, Medicare).
